Perception
and Reality
|
|
Neither
reality nor perception stand alone in public relations.
The key to influencing public opinion is taking the
reality of a situation and presenting it in a way that
creates the strongest positive impression. Business
drives the PR machine, not the other way around.
Executives should start to worry when the tail begins to
wag the dog.

Spring
Cleaning
With
spring right around the corner, now is a good time to
think about cleaning up your media lists, contact lists,
email folders, etc.
While
you are at it, you may want to take a look at your media
kit and make sure that it has been updated. If you
have an online media kit, make sure that all of your
links still go to viable web pages. |
